Bill overview
This bill, the Infrastructure Project Acceleration Act, aims to speed up the approval process for large manufacturing projects in the United States. It defines ‘priority manufacturing projects’ as facilities costing at least $1 billion that require federal approvals. The bill modifies the National Environmental Policy Act (NEPA) to streamline environmental reviews, particularly when a state or tribal agency has already conducted a similar review. It also limits judicial review of approvals for these projects, ensuring quicker project completion.
